Autocross School / Test & Tune
OK guys here's a chance to work on your skills or just get started in a non-points event. Should be a great day at Sunny South. The following was taken from The Gulf Coast Region's Website.
Next Event at Sunny South Speedway
November 16, 2008
Autocross school/test and tune
Price is set at flat fee for all participants at 30 dollars.
Event is open to all members and non-members ages 16 and up.
Minors must be accompanied by legal guardian and have minor waiver completed and submitted at registration.
Schedule:
Gates open at 7:00 am
Registration and tech 7:30
Drivers meeting 8:30 with course discussion and instructor student assignment.
Test and tune participants will be on course by 9:30
Students will join in when ready.
Morning course lay out will be grouped into Skid pad section and a separate acceleration slalom and braking section.
Short break for lunch and re-set course.
Afternoon course will be basic Autocross course to practice and provide as much seat time as day-light will permit.
Timer will be running to provide driver feedback.
